The putative pulsar-wind nebulae of the three Musketeers PSR B1055-52, B0656+14 and Geminga revisited

We report on the analysis of archival ASCA, ROSAT and BeppoSAX data of PSR B1055-52, PSR B0656+14 and Geminga, performed in order to investigate the reality of the putative ~10-20 arcmin wide X-ray pulsar-wind nebulae recently proposed to exist around these pulsars. In all these cases, the ROSAT and/or BeppoSAX data show that the diffuse and clumpy X-ray nebulae found by ASCA can be resolved in the contribution of unidentified point sources, unlikely related to the pulsars.
